Understanding Umbrella Company Structures in Relation to IR35
Umbrella companies have emerged as a common structure for independent contractors within the UK, particularly in sectors such as Software development. These entities function by employing contractors and then supplying them to various clients on contractual assignments. Nevertheless, the advent of IR35 legislation has brought significant challenges to this arrangement, aiming to ensure that contractors operating through umbrella companies are correctly classified for tax purposes. IR35 seeks to prevent individuals from being treated as self-employed while effectively working like employees, thereby guaranteeing they pay the appropriate level of national insurance and income tax.
- Hence, it is crucial for contractors to grasp the intricate relationship between umbrella company structures and IR35 legislation.
- This involves carefully evaluating their working practices, contracts, and the specific arrangements offered by the umbrella company they choose to work with.
Understanding IR35: Umbrella Companies' Part in Contractor Compliance
Within the complex landscape of IR35 legislation, umbrella companies play a significant role in ensuring contractor observance. By acting as an intermediary between contractors and businesses, they help to streamline payments and manage the administrative responsibilities associated with IR35. Umbrella companies frequently handle tasks such as calculating taxes, processing PAYE, and ensuring contractors meet their legal requirements. This can reduce the pressure on contractors, allowing them to devote their efforts to their core specialisms.
- Moreover, umbrella companies often extend valuable support to contractors on IR35 concerns. This can include information about contract types and the current legislation, helping contractors to make well-considered decisions about their projects.
